The messaging app is used for multiple reasons, from an informal chat with friends to work discussions with bosses. The application allows its users to connect with their acquaintances; however, the app links our phone number to the accounts, making it possible for it to fall into the hands of strangers. How to know who has added us is very simple thanks to this trick.
- The first step will be create a new broadcast list
- Then you must send a message on this created channel,
- When the recipients open the chat and read the message you will be able to view it,
- To see who read the message you must long press sent message and click on the option “Info” when the menu is displayed
- WhatsApp will show the phones of those who have received and read the message. In addition, here you will be able to know whether or not a person has our contact number in the agenda, even though we do not have them added.
In the mass message you will get the numbers of unknown people that you have not added, but who have as a contact. However, you can do something about it.
To prevent strangers who have added you from knowing less about you, you can configure security filters of the app to prevent them from knowing your connection time or profile photo.
How to change your privacy settings
By default, WhatsApp sets the privacy settings to allow the following:
- Any user can see your last. time, profile picture, info. and read confirmation
- Your contacts can see your status updates
- Any user can add you to groups
To change it, you just have to follow the following steps:
- Android: Touch More options> Settings> Account> Privacy.
- iPhone: Tap Settings> Account> Privacy.
